Q01What is the pincode of Satnai?
+
The pincode of Satnai, Khurai tehsil, Sagar district, Madhya Pradesh is 470117. The post office is Khurai.
Q02Which post office delivers to Satnai?
+
Mail for Satnai is delivered through Khurai post office, pincode 470117, in Khurai tehsil, Sagar district. Use the full village name and the pincode on envelopes and courier forms.
Q03In which district is Satnai located?
+
Satnai is a village in Khurai tehsil of Sagar district, Madhya Pradesh, India.
Q04What is the population of Satnai as per Census 2011?
+
As per the 2011 Census, Satnai village has a population of 590 across 146 households.
Q05Which Lok Sabha constituency is Satnai in?
+
Satnai falls under the Sagar Lok Sabha constituency (PC #5) of Madhya Pradesh.
Q06Which Vidhan Sabha (assembly) constituency is Satnai in?
+
Satnai falls under the Bina assembly constituency (AC #35) of Madhya Pradesh.
Q07What is the literacy rate in Satnai?
+
The Census 2011 literacy rate for Satnai village is 58.8%.
Q08What is the sex ratio in Satnai?
+
The Census 2011 sex ratio for Satnai village is 855 females per 1,000 males.
